Centuri achieves record revenue in Q2 2026, but misses adjusted EPS target
Centuri reported record Q2 2026 revenue of $962m (+33% y/y), but adjusted EPS was $0.24, well below consensus of $0.45. Adjusted net income rose 44% to $24.4m, while adjusted EBITDA and EBIT increased slightly. The stock fell about 12.4% in premarket trading after the earnings miss. The company confirmed full-year revenue of $3.5–3.7bn (base) or $3.59–3.79bn in total, expects adjusted EBITDA of $285–310m, and sees improved free cash flow potential for 2026. » More on de.investing.com
Centuri Holdings: shareholders approve all proposals at annual general meeting
At Centuri Holdings’ annual general meeting, shareholders approved all presented resolutions, including the election of all nominated directors and a non-binding advisory vote on executive compensation. The employee stock purchase plan and the reappointment of PricewaterhouseCoopers as auditor were also approved. Holders of 89,191,565 common shares were represented at the meeting. The stock has gained 62% over the past year and is trading at $30.20, while first-quarter 2026 reported EPS was -$0.09, missing expectations despite revenue growth; one analysis currently views the stock as trading above its fair value. » More on de.investing.com
Centuri presents 'Vision One Centuri' and targets 10–15% annual growth through 2029
Centuri unveiled a strategic growth program aiming for 10–15% annual organic revenue growth and a gross margin expansion of 70–170 basis points by 2029. At the same time, the company reported a Q1 loss of $0.09 per share, although revenue rose 31% to $723 million and adjusted EBITDA increased 35%; the stock fell about 19.6% after hours. Management also targets a marked improvement in free‑cash‑flow conversion and a reduction in net debt, but risks remain including seasonality, integration and labor‑market issues, and high leverage. » More on de.investing.com

Company profile
Centuri Holdings, Inc. ist ein Unternehmen für Versorgungsinfrastrukturdienste in Nordamerika. Das Unternehmen ist in vier Segmenten tätig: U.S. Gas Utility Services; Canadian Gas Utility Services; Union Electric Utility Services; und Non-Union Electric Utility Services. Das Unternehmen bietet Gasversorgungsdienste an, einschließlich Wartung, Austausch, Reparatur und Installation für lokale Erdgasversorgungsunternehmen, die sich auf die Modernisierung der Infrastruktur ihrer Kunden konzentrieren. Das Unternehmen bietet auch Stromversorgungsdienste an, die Wartung, Ersatz, Reparatur, Aufrüstung und Erweiterung der städtischen Übertragungs- und lokalen Verteilungsinfrastruktur umfassen. Zu den Kunden des Unternehmens zählen Strom-, Gas- und kombinierte Versorgungsunternehmen sowie Endmärkte wie erneuerbare Energien, Rechenzentren und 5G Datacom. Das Unternehmen wurde 1909 gegründet und hat seinen Hauptsitz in Phoenix, Arizona. Centuri Holdings, Inc. ist eine Tochtergesellschaft von Southwest Gas Holdings, Inc.
